Your Patron Account accesses your account info, including holds, blocks, items checked out and due date(s).  You may reserve and renew most items.

 LOGGING IN:

Click the Your Patron Account link.  Enter your Patron Barcode (the long number that appears on your library card) in the indicated box.  In the box labeled "Enter Your Pin #", enter the last 4 digits of your home telephone number (unless you have previously arranged for something else as your pin number).  Click "Login."

You will be taken to Account Overview, which includes four sections.  Click on any of the headings to go to that section:

 PLACING HOLDS (RESERVING ITEMS):

  1. Search the catalog (by clicking on the "LINC" tab) to find the item you want.  You may search a variety of ways (title, author, subject, keyword, etc.) by entering your search terms and clicking the arrow next to the search box to select the appropriate index.  For additional information about searching, or other LINC functions, visit our LINC Help Screen.
  2. Once you have found the item you want, click its title.  A full record will appear listing details about the item.  At the bottom of the page is a green/tan box labeled "Copy/Holding Information."  If the item is owned by Danville Public Library, this will be indicated here.  If the box is empty, the item is owned by another library in the Lincoln Trail system.  Click "Other Locations" to find out who owns it.
  3. Click the box "Request Any Copy."  If you are not already logged in to your account, the computer will prompt you to do so.
  4. A Request Confirmation will appear.  By default, requested items are sent to your home library [i.e. where you received your card], but you may change the pickup location at this pointYou must click "Request" to complete the transaction.  If successful, a confirmation message will appear.  If unsuccessful, an error message will appear.  Note that an error message will appear if you attempt to reserve an item you have already placed on hold.

Items may also be reserved in person or by phone (217-477-5220).

 RENEWING ITEMS:

Click "Items Out" in the "Account Overview" section (described above in "Logging In").  To renew an item, check the empty box to the left of the item's title, then click the "Renew" box.  If the renewal is successful, the new due date will appear.  

Items may also be renewed in person or by phone (217-477-5220).

NOTE: Not all items may be renewed.  This includes items which are on hold for another patron; items which have already been renewed the maximum number of times; and certain types of material, such as some audiovisual items.  In all of these cases, a message will appear in red indicating that the material was not renewed.
